<div class="blockk">Free memory: 29568 b.<br><hr>
<div class="blockk">Free memory: (.+?).<br><hr>
import java.util.regex.Matcher;
import java.util.regex.Pattern;
public class RegexMatches
{
public static void main( String args[] ){
// Строка, которую будем парсить
String line = "<div class=\\"blockk\\">Free memory: 29568 b.<br><hr>";
// Наша регулярка
String pattern = "<div class=\\"blockk\\">Free memory: (.+?).<br><hr>";
Pattern r = Pattern.compile(pattern);
Matcher m = r.matcher(line);
// Если нашли то выводим
while (m.find( )) {
System.out.println("Found value: " + m.group(0) );
} else {
System.out.println("NO MATCH");
}
}
}
Free memory: ([^\.]+).